    Abstract: The invention relates in particular to a loudspeaker system for Integration into a wall or ceiling surface, comprising at least one low-frequency loudspeaker (10) and at least one mid-range loudspeaker (11), which is designed as a flat surface loudspeaker and has a front side (12) which is at least partially provided to form a homogeneous surface with the surrounding wall or ceiling surface.

    Abstract: Multifunctional LED devices and multifunctional LED wireless conference systems are provided. A multifunctional LED device includes an LED drive and power supply unit, a controller unit, an audio power amplifier unit, a speaker unit, a wireless transceiver module, a microphone module, and an LED light source assemble. The wireless transceiver module can communicate with a smart terminal and other multifunctional LED devices. A multifunctional LED wireless conference system includes at least two multifunctional LED devices and a smart terminal capable of reading a status of and remotely controlling the multifunctional LED devices. The smart terminal communicates with outside terminals to send audio signals from the outside terminals to the multifunctional LED devices for broadcasting. Meanwhile, the multifunctional LED devices collect ambient sound and send the ambient sound to the outside terminals via the smart terminal such that wireless conference function can be achieved.

    Abstract: The present invention comprises a loudspeaker system that includes a loudspeaker and a detachable mount. In one or more embodiments, the loudspeaker and mount include electrical connectors that are engaged when the loudspeaker is attached to the mount. In one or more embodiments, the loudspeaker and mount comprise mating mounting structures that support the loudspeaker on the mount when the mounting structure of the loudspeaker is engaged with the mounting structure of the mount. In one or more embodiments, multiple configurations of the mount are provided that allow the loudspeaker to be mounted with a variety of orientations with respect to the mounting surface. In one or more embodiments, the loudspeaker comprises a tweeter with a rotatable wave guide that allows the dispersion angle of the tweeter to be adjusted to accommodate the variety of orientations at which the loudspeaker may be mounted.

    Abstract: An object of the present invention is to provide a speaker mounting device which does not permit a dismounting work without using a tool but enables an easy dismounting work using the tool. A speaker mounting device 1 of the present invention comprises a speaker component 2 provided at a speaker, and a wall component 3 to be provided at a wall.
    The speaker component 2 is configured to be slid in a first direction with respect to the wall component to be mounted to the wall component 3. The speaker component 2 is configured to be slid in a second direction with respect to the wall component 3 to be dismounted from the wall component 3. The speaker component 1 includes a movement prevention member 5 and a shaft member 6 coupled to the movement prevention member 5. The shaft member 6 is rotated to cause the movement prevention member 5 to rotate around the shaft member 6 which is a rotational axis. The shaft member 6 has an outer end of a screw head shape or a bolt head shape. The wall component 3 is positioned in the second direction relative to a rotational trajectory of the movement prevention member 5 in a state where the speaker component 2 is mounted to the wall component 3.
